DRAGON, the fourth Type 45 anti-air warfare destroyer built by BAE Systems for the Royal Navy, has arrived in Portsmouth Naval Base, where she will be handed over to the Ministry of Defence (MOD) at a ceremony today.Members of the ship’s company will raise the white ensign for the first time onboard DRAGON, as the Head of Destroyers, Commodore Stephen Braham, formally accepts the destroyer on behalf of the MOD in Portsmouth, where she joins her sister ships HMS DARING, HMS DAUNTLESS and HMS DIAMOND.
Paul Rafferty, Type 45 Programme Director at BAE Systems’ Surface Ships business, said: “DRAGON is the most advanced Type 45 destroyer delivered to date.
